What Makes Chicken the Best for Grilling?

In terms of nutrition, chicken stands out as a lean protein source, providing essential nutrients without excessive fat. This makes it appealing to health-conscious individuals who still want to enjoy a flavorful grilled meal.

Another benefit of grilling chicken is its relatively short cooking time. Most chicken cuts can be grilled in 10 to 20 minutes, which is convenient for quick weeknight dinners or impromptu gatherings.

Lastly, when grilled correctly, chicken offers a delightful combination of textures. The high heat of the grill creates a satisfying crispy skin or charred exterior, while the meat inside remains juicy, providing a pleasurable eating experience that is hard to resist.

Which Marinades Enhance the Flavor of Grilled Chicken?

The best marinades for enhancing the flavor of grilled chicken include a variety of ingredients that add depth and complexity to the meat.

  • Citrus Marinade: A mixture of lemon or lime juice, olive oil, garlic, and herbs.
  • Teriyaki Marinade: A sweet and savory blend of soy sauce, sugar, ginger, and garlic.
  • Yogurt Marinade: A creamy combination of yogurt, spices, and herbs that tenderizes the chicken.
  • Balsamic Vinegar Marinade: A tangy mix of balsamic vinegar, olive oil, honey, and herbs.
  • Spicy Marinade: A fiery concoction of hot sauce, vinegar, garlic, and cumin.

The citrus marinade is refreshing and bright, effectively tenderizing the chicken while infusing it with a zesty flavor profile. The acidity from the citrus helps break down the proteins, resulting in a juicy and flavorful piece of meat.

Teriyaki marinade offers a unique balance of sweetness and umami, making it a popular choice for those who enjoy Asian-inspired flavors. The soy sauce provides a salty base, while the sugar caramelizes on the grill, creating a delicious glaze.

Yogurt marinade is particularly effective for tenderizing chicken due to its acidity and enzymes. The yogurt not only adds moisture but also contributes a tangy flavor that complements various spices and herbs.

Balsamic vinegar marinade brings a rich, sweet and tangy flavor that works beautifully with grilled chicken. The honey in the marinade helps to create a beautiful caramelization on the grill, adding an extra layer of flavor.

Spicy marinade is perfect for those who enjoy a kick in their grilled chicken. The combination of hot sauce and spices not only enhances the flavor but also adds heat, making for a bold and exciting dish.

How Should Chicken Be Prepared for the Grill?

To achieve the best chicken grilled, various preparation methods can be employed to enhance flavor and texture.

  • Marination: Marinating chicken involves soaking it in a flavorful mixture of acids, oils, and spices for a period of time before grilling. This not only infuses the meat with taste but also helps to tenderize it, making the chicken juicier when cooked.
  • Brining: Brining is the process of soaking chicken in a saltwater solution, often with added herbs and spices. This method allows the chicken to absorb moisture, resulting in a more succulent and flavorful final product when grilled.
  • Dry Rubs: Applying a dry rub, which is a blend of spices and herbs, to the surface of the chicken before grilling can create a flavorful crust. The rub caramelizes during grilling, adding depth to the flavor and an appealing texture.
  • Spatchcocking: Spatchcocking involves removing the backbone of the chicken and flattening it out for even cooking. This technique allows for quicker grilling and promotes uniform browning, ensuring that both the dark and white meat are cooked perfectly.
  • Pre-cooking Methods: Techniques such as poaching or parboiling the chicken before grilling can help reduce grilling time and ensure that the meat is thoroughly cooked. This method is especially useful for thicker cuts, as it helps prevent the outside from burning while the inside remains undercooked.
  • Choosing the Right Cut: Selecting the appropriate cut of chicken is crucial for grilling success. Thighs and drumsticks are generally more forgiving due to their higher fat content, while breasts can dry out if overcooked, so adjusting cooking times and temperatures is essential based on the cut chosen.

What Temperature is Ideal for Grilling Chicken?

The ideal temperature for grilling chicken can be categorized primarily into two types: direct and indirect heat.

  • Direct Heat (Medium-High Heat, 375°F – 450°F): This method is ideal for cooking chicken pieces like breasts, thighs, and wings quickly and evenly.
  • Indirect Heat (Low to Medium Heat, 300°F – 350°F): This technique is best suited for larger cuts such as whole chickens or bone-in parts, allowing for thorough cooking without burning the exterior.
  • Internal Temperature (165°F): Regardless of the cooking method, ensuring the chicken reaches an internal temperature of 165°F is essential for food safety and optimal juiciness.

Direct Heat (Medium-High Heat, 375°F – 450°F): Grilling chicken over direct heat allows for a nice sear on the outside while keeping the inside moist. The high temperature helps in developing a flavorful crust, making it perfect for smaller cuts that require less cooking time.

Indirect Heat (Low to Medium Heat, 300°F – 350°F): Cooking chicken using indirect heat is advantageous for larger pieces, as it prevents the outside from charring before the inside is fully cooked. This method involves placing the chicken away from the direct flame, often using a covered grill to circulate heat evenly around the meat.

Internal Temperature (165°F): The USDA recommends cooking chicken to an internal temperature of 165°F to eliminate harmful bacteria. Using a meat thermometer is the best way to check doneness, ensuring the chicken is not only safe to eat but also tender and juicy.

How Can You Ensure Your Grilled Chicken Stays Juicy?

Cooking at the right temperature is crucial; ideally, you should grill chicken over medium heat. This ensures that the outside doesn’t char before the inside is cooked through, which is essential for maintaining juiciness.

Using a meat thermometer is an effective way to ensure chicken is cooked to the right internal temperature, which is 165°F (75°C) for poultry. By checking the temperature, you can avoid the common mistake of overcooking, which leads to dry meat.

Letting the grilled chicken rest for about 5-10 minutes after cooking is important because it allows the juices to redistribute throughout the meat. Cutting into the chicken too soon can cause the juices to run out, resulting in a drier piece of meat.

What Are Creative Ways to Serve Grilled Chicken?

There are numerous creative ways to serve grilled chicken that can elevate the dining experience.

  • Grilled Chicken Tacos: Serve grilled chicken in soft or hard taco shells with fresh toppings like avocado, salsa, and cilantro. This approach allows for a fun, interactive meal where guests can customize their tacos with various salsas and garnishes.
  • Grilled Chicken Salad: Slice grilled chicken and serve it atop a bed of mixed greens, nuts, and seasonal vegetables. Adding a zesty dressing can enhance the flavors and make the salad a filling and nutritious option.
  • Grilled Chicken Skewers: Cut the chicken into bite-sized pieces, marinate, and thread onto skewers with colorful vegetables. These skewers are visually appealing and make for easy eating, perfect for parties or barbecues.
  • Grilled Chicken Sandwiches: Use grilled chicken breast as the star of a hearty sandwich, layered with cheese, lettuce, tomatoes, and your choice of sauce. This method offers a satisfying meal that can be enjoyed on the go or as a sit-down option.
  • Grilled Chicken Pasta: Toss sliced grilled chicken with pasta, seasonal vegetables, and a creamy or tomato-based sauce. The combination of flavors and textures creates a comforting dish that’s easy to prepare and delicious.
  • Grilled Chicken Pizza: Top a pizza crust with grilled chicken, barbecue sauce, cheese, and your favorite toppings. This fusion dish combines the smoky flavor of grilled chicken with the cheesy goodness of pizza, perfect for a casual meal.
  • Stuffed Peppers with Grilled Chicken: Mix grilled chicken with rice, beans, and spices, then stuff into halved bell peppers and grill or bake. This colorful dish is not only nutritious but also makes for a great presentation when served.
  • Grilled Chicken Buddha Bowl: Create a vibrant bowl filled with grains, grilled chicken, and an assortment of vegetables, topped with a flavorful sauce. This meal is both visually appealing and highly customizable, catering to various dietary preferences.
